John Holiday Wins Praise for His Performance in Alcina at the Bayerische Staatsoper

American countertenor John Holiday returned to the Bayerische Staatsoper for the 2026 Munich Opera Festival, earning praise for his compelling portrayal of Ruggiero in Handel's Alcina. Read highlights from the reviews below.

"John Holiday's Ruggiero combined lyrical warmth with heroic conviction, while Elsa Benoit dazzled as Morgana with her luminous voice and flawless coloratura, reaching a high point in an exhilarating "Tornami a vagheggiar." - Opera Magazine

"The American countertenor John Holiday also impressed with his wonderfully precise and sparkling vocal embellishments in a creative portrayal of Ruggiero." - Bachtrack

"John Holiday proved an equally compelling Ruggiero, combining lyrical warmth with impressive dramatic conviction. His countertenor remained remarkably even throughout its compass, the voice moving effortlessly between moments of heroic brilliance and lyrical introspection...." - OperaWire

"With a voice of crystalline purity and a masterful use of resonant head tones that filled the hall, his luminous color, sweetly shaped phrasing, and hypnotic metallic timbre made him irresistible." - Platea Magazine

"American countertenor John Holiday here proved an outstanding Ruggiero. Possessing an unusually warm, evenly produced countertenor, he combined vocal refinement with considerable dramatic intelligence." - ConcertoNet
